World Bank Water at COP27: Sustainable Water Storage and River Basin Management for Resilience
keyFrameImage
description
Today, most countries are placing unprecedented pressure on water resources, and water scarcity affects more than 40% of the global population. Water storage is a key part of responding to increased water demands across all uses, and especially in responding to the impacts of climate change. This COP27 session presents the World Bank’s upcoming report on water storage: "What the Future has in Store: A New Paradigm for Climate-Resilient Water Storage." This is followed by short presentations on examples of storage and water resources management from across the globe.
